The height of a cone is half the diameter of its base. If the cone’s height is 4 inches, what is the cone’s volume to the neares

t cubic inch?

Answer:

67 cubic inches

Step-by-step explanation:

Given height of cone = 4 inches

Given height  of cone is  half of diameter of base of cone

If D is diameter, then

4 inches = 1/2 D

=> D = 8 inches

Radius for any circle  is half of diameter of circle.

Thus for given cone

radius = 1/2 D = 1/2 * 8 = inches.

Area of circle is given by \pi r^2 where r is radius of circle.

Thus area of given base of cone is given as below

\pi 4^2\\=> 3.14 *16\\=>50.24

We know that volume of cone is given by

volume = 1/3(area of base * height)

Thus,

volume of given cone = 1/3(50.24)*4  =66.98 cubic inches

volume of cone in nearest cubic inches is 67 .

ZA and ZB are complementary angles. If<br> the measure of ZA is 42°, find the measure<br> of ZB.
Sunny_sXe [5.5K]
Answer: ZB = 48 degree

Explanation:

Complementary angle means 2 angel add together and create a right angle (90 degree).

Thus, ZA + ZB = 90 degree
But ZA = 42 degree

=> 42 degree + ZB = 90 degree
=> ZB = (90 - 42)degree
=> ZB = 48 degree

Solve the inequality x - 4 &lt; -3. Then graph the solution set. Show your work. ​
kari74 [83]

Answer:

x < 1

Step-by-step explanation:

x - 4 < - 3

+ 4    +4                        Do inverse operations by adding 4 on both sides

   x < 1

Therefore, the answer is x < 1.

(It isn't allowing me to attach a photo but I am just going to try make a visual of the graph below)

<------------------------------o------------------>

-4    -3    -2    -1     0    1     2    3      4

The circle is open because based on the concept that in inequalities, less/greater than and/or equal to (such as these ≥ ≤ ) signs are graphed with closed circles, while less/greater than (like these > <) signs are graphed with open circles. The direction of the arrow is moving to the left on the number line because all possible values for x would be less than 1.
